POP-UP COSMETIC CONTAINER
A pop-up cosmetic container includes a lid assembly, a coupling rod, an inner sleeve, an intermediate lid, and a shell assembly, where the lid assembly is sleeved outside the intermediate lid, and an end of the intermediate lid is stretched out of the lid assembly; the intermediate lid is sleeved outside the inner sleeve; the inner sleeve is sleeved outside the shell assembly; the coupling rod is rotatably provided in the lid assembly; and a first side of the coupling rod is connected to the intermediate lid, and a second side of the coupling rod is connected to the inner sleeve. With a seesaw-like function of the coupling rod, the shell assembly can be popped up by pushing the intermediate lid. With the operating end and the pop-up end located at a same end, the pop-up cosmetic container facilitates single-handed operation of the user.

BACKGROUNDWith development of the society and humanity, cosmetics have quickly become prevailing in life. Cosmetics such as lipstick, lip gloss, and lip balm have been widely used. Most conventional containers for lipstick and the like are of a snap-on type or a magnetically attractable type. The lid and the shell in the snap-on container are clamped with each other, while the lid and the shell in the magnetically attractable container are magnetically attracted to each other. Hence, these containers must be opened with the help of two hands, which causes inconvenience in operation. Moreover, these containers are structurally simple, and not interesting.

The present application has the following beneficial effects: The pop-up cosmetic container includes the outer lid, the inner lid, the coupling rod, the inner sleeve, the intermediate lid, and the shell assembly. The inner lid is fixedly provided in the outer lid. The outer lid, the inner lid, the inner sleeve, and the shell assembly are arranged sequentially from outside to inside. The coupling rod includes one side connected to the intermediate lid, and the other side connected to the inner sleeve. The inner sleeve is clamped with the inner lid. When the intermediate lid is stressed to move toward the lid assembly, the intermediate lid pushes one side of the coupling rod to move up, and the other side of the coupling rod moves down, such that the inner sleeve is stressed to separate from the inner lid. Under an action of resilience of the elastic member, the inner sleeve and the shell assembly are popped up out of the lid assembly. The shell assembly is pulled out for use. Therefore, with a seesaw-like function of the coupling rod, the shell assembly can be popped up by pushing the intermediate lid. With the operating end and the pop-up end located at a same end, the present application facilitates single-handed operation of the user. The present application is operated conveniently and makes the product more interesting.

The operation process in the present application includes the following steps:
Step 1: Initially, the cosmetic container is in the closed state, as shown in
Step 2: By pressing the intermediate lid 50 inward, the intermediate lid 50 drives the first connecting member 32 of the coupling rod to move up. The second connecting member 33 of the coupling rod moves down to provide the horizontal component force for the third limiting member 41, such that the third limiting member is bent leftward to separate from the first limiting member 23, as shown in
Step 3: The constraint force on the elastic member 25 disappears. The elastic member 25 is restored to drive the inner sleeve and the shell assembly 60 to move down, such that the shell assembly is popped up out of the outer lid 10, as shown in
